The relevant error is
---
Setting up linux-image-2.6.31-15-generic (2.6.31-15.50) ...
Running depmod.
update-initramfs: Generating /boot/initrd.img-2.6.31-15-generic
Not updating initrd symbolic links since we are being updated/reinstalled
(2.6.31-15.50 was configured last, according to dpkg)
Not updating image symbolic links since we are being updated/reinstalled
(2.6.31-15.50 was configured last, according to dpkg)
Running postinst hook script /usr/sbin/update-grub.
Generating grub.cfg ...
Found linux image: /boot/vmlinuz-2.6.31-15-generic-pae
Found initrd image: /boot/initrd.img-2.6.31-15-generic-pae
Found linux image: /boot/vmlinuz-2.6.31-15-generic
Found initrd image: /boot/initrd.img-2.6.31-15-generic
Found linux image: /boot/vmlinuz-2.6.31-14-generic
Found initrd image: /boot/initrd.img-2.6.31-14-generic
Found memtest86+ image: /boot/memtest86+.bin
done
Examining /etc/kernel/postinst.d.
run-parts: executing /etc/kernel/postinst.d/nvidia-common
run-parts: failed to exec /etc/kernel/postinst.d/nvidia-common: Exec format
error
run-parts: /etc/kernel/postinst.d/nvidia-common exited with return code 1
This usually means a 0 byte length or corrupted
/etc/kernel/postinst.d/nvidia-common . A workaround is to remove the file,
purge and reinstall the package.
